Abstract

The development of various fields of engineering and technology is inextricably linked with the creation of new polymeric and composite materials with predetermined various physical and mechanical properties. The paper considers linear natural vibrations of a viscoelastic three-layer shallow spherical shell with the most common types of boundary conditions (sliding pinching, free support, etc.). The problem is reduced to the consideration of a single-layer spherical shell. The aim of the work is to formulate and solve the problem of natural oscillations of viscoelastic multilayer spherical shells. Based on the methods of differential equations in partial derivatives, a frequency equation with complex output parameters is obtained. The problem of natural oscillations of viscoelastic multilayer spherical shells is posed and solved. An equation of resonant frequencies is obtained, which makes it possible to implement the construction of eigenmodes and numerical results.
